Basketball Preview: Newman Grove/St. Edward Panthers vs. Riverside Chargers
The Newman Grove/St. Edward Panthers will venture away from home to take on the Riverside Chargers at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day.
Newman Grove/St. Edward is headed into the contest out to prove that what happened against Archangels Catholic on Tuesday (when they were outscored in every quarter) was just a minor bump in the road. Newman Grove/St. Edward was beaten by Archangels Catholic 54-26. While losing is never fun, the Panthers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Nebraska basketball rankings (they are ranked 237th, while the Defenders are ranked 83rd).
Newman Grove/St. Edward's defeat came about despite a quality game from Marcos Paez, who posted nine points along with six rebounds and four steals. The team also got some help courtesy of Anthony Reader, who had ten points.
Meanwhile, a well-balanced attack led Riverside over Palmer in every quarter on their way to victory on Friday. Given that consistent dominance, it should come as no surprise that Riverside blew Palmer out of the water with a 62-24 final score. With the Chargers ahead 30-7 at the half, the match was all but over already.
Riverside is on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four games, which provided a nice bump to their 9-9 record this season.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 58.0 points per game. As for Newman Grove/St. Edward, they have been struggling recently as they've lost four of their last five contests, which put a noticeable dent in their 6-8 record this season.
